Hello!
Change to a common denominator: 45
5/9 = 25/45
- 4/5 = - 36/45
[tex] \frac{25}{45} +( -\frac{36}{45} ) = \frac{25}{45} - \frac{36}{45} = -\frac{11}{45} [/tex]
Positive and Negative = Negative
Your answer is the last choice ⇒ [tex] -\frac{11}{45} [/tex]
